The Italy Packaging Coatings Market was valued at $117.6 Million in 2024 and projected to reach to $142.8 Million by 2029, representing a compound annual growth rate of 4.0%. Italy's packaging coatings market is positioned for moderate but consistent growth through 2029, driven by the country's strong food and beverage export industry and manufacturing capabilities.

Italy Packaging Coatings Market Dynamics

  • The 4% CAGR reflects steady demand from premium packaging applications, particularly in wine, olive oil, and specialty food sectors where protective coatings add significant value.
  • Regulatory compliance with EU sustainability standards is reshaping product development, with manufacturers investing in water-based and low-VOC formulations.
  • The market benefits from Italy's established supply chains and technical expertise in coating applications.
  • However, growth remains tempered by competitive pricing pressures and the shift toward lighter packaging formats, requiring innovation in coating efficiency and performance..

        ITALY: PACKAGING COATINGS MARKET, BY APPLICATION, 2024–2029

        Segment202420252026202720282029CAGR (%)
        FLEXIBLE PACKAGING51.153.155.157.259.361.43.8
        PAPER PACKAGING42.544.446.448.550.552.64.4
        RIGID PACKAGING242525.926.827.828.83.6
        TOTAL117.6122.5127.5132.5137.6142.84

        Market Definition

        “According to the “American Coatings Association,” packaging coatings are specialized layers applied to the surfaces of packaging materials to enhance their functionality, durability, and aesthetics. These coatings serve multiple purposes, including protecting the contents from environmental factors like moisture, oxygen, and UV light, improving the barrier properties of the packaging, and offering additional features such as heat resistance or anti-microbial protection. Packaging coatings are widely used in industries such as food and beverages, pharmaceuticals, and cosmetics to ensure product safety and extend shelf life”.
